Форум КриптоПро
»
Средства криптографической защиты информации
»
КриптоПро .NET
»
Ошибка 0x800b0105 при вызове CadesMsgEnhanceSignatureAll из cades.dll
Статус: Активный участник
Группы: Участники
Зарегистрирован: 10.07.2014(UTC) Сообщений: 108  Откуда: Москва Сказал(а) «Спасибо»: 25 раз
|
Добрый день. 1. При вызове функции "CadesMsgEnhanceSignatureAll" из "cades.dll" получаю ошибку с кодом 0x800b0105 - что она означает? Лог из "DbgView" в аттачменте. 2. Есть какой-то способ переводить коды ошибок функций из "cades.dll" во что-то более понятное? С уважением, Константин Ткачук. Вложение(я):  1.LOG (82kb) загружен 3 раз(а).У Вас нет прав для просмотра или загрузки вложений. Попробуйте зарегистрироваться.
|
|
|
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 10.07.2014(UTC) Сообщений: 108  Откуда: Москва Сказал(а) «Спасибо»: 25 раз
|
Добрый день. Хоть какой-нибудь ответ будет? Я пытаюсь "расширить" подпись до CADES LONG TYPE 1 - она не "расширяется". Что я не так делаю? В аттачменте подпись и исходный файл. С уважением, Константин Ткачук. Вложение(я):  cms (4kb) загружен 1 раз(а). file (371kb) загружен 1 раз(а).У Вас нет прав для просмотра или загрузки вложений. Попробуйте зарегистрироваться.
|
|
|
|
|
|
Статус: Сотрудник
Группы: Участники
Зарегистрирован: 26.07.2011(UTC) Сообщений: 14,113   Сказал «Спасибо»: 615 раз Поблагодарили: 2381 раз в 1873 постах
|
Вот что нашел: CERT_E_CRITICAL = 0x800B0105 A certificate contains an unknown extension that is marked 'critical'. |
|
 1 пользователь поблагодарил Андрей * за этот пост.
|
idtks оставлено 14.11.2014(UTC)
|
|
|
Статус: Активный участник
Группы: Участники
Зарегистрирован: 10.07.2014(UTC) Сообщений: 108  Откуда: Москва Сказал(а) «Спасибо»: 25 раз
|
Действительно, в используемом сертификате есть одно "критичное расширение": поле "Использование ключа" (со значением "Цифровая подпись, Неотрекаемость, Шифрование ключей, Шифрование данных (f0)") - неужели из-за него все ломается? УЦ "КриптоПРО" может создавать сертификаты где это поле не имело бы флаг "критичного"? Или можно как-то "снять" этот флаг у уже созданного сертификата?
С уважением, Константин Ткачук.
|
|
|
|
|
|
Форум КриптоПро
»
Средства криптографической защиты информации
»
КриптоПро .NET
»
Ошибка 0x800b0105 при вызове CadesMsgEnhanceSignatureAll из cades.dll
Быстрый переход
Вы не можете создавать новые темы в этом форуме.
Вы не можете отвечать в этом форуме.
Вы не можете удалять Ваши сообщения в этом форуме.
Вы не можете редактировать Ваши сообщения в этом форуме.
Вы не можете создавать опросы в этом форуме.
Вы не можете голосовать в этом форуме.
Important Information:
The Форум КриптоПро uses cookies. By continuing to browse this site, you are agreeing to our use of cookies.
More Details
Close